XX Kinwald
Picked this up off EBAY not knowing it was a Kinwald actually. It is pretty rough but with all the new graphite parts I just put on my regualr XX I certainly could create an almost new Kinwald between the two. Hmmmmmm? One thing of note, the rear graphite arms on the Kinwald are different than the rear graphite arms which I bought for the regular XX. Different hole patterns as shown.

Re: XX Kinwald
So, they are not only XXX arms, but XXX BK2 with the VLA.
About shocks, no worries, thay are exactly the same, fore sure, excepted the Golden shock shafts.
The blue rear springs of the Kinwald, was in fact a set of pink, painted in blue to complete the blue package.
